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Damage Restoration
Catching the warning sign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the signs. Here are some common warning signs that show you need Basement Water Damage Restoration: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a musty smell in your basement that won’t go away,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it. Water can seep into your home through cracks and crevices, causing mold growth and unpleasant odors. We’ll get rid of the smell.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
If your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t delay. Water can seep into the subfloor and cause the flooring to warp or buckle. We’ll fix it.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
If your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it. Water can seep into the walls and cause the paint or wallpaper to peel. We’ll fix it.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
If you notice water stains on the ceiling,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t delay. Water can seep into the ceiling and cause stains. We’ll fix it.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
If you notice unusual sounds or leaks in your basement,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it. Water can seep into your home through cracks and crevices, causing leaks and unusual sounds. We’ll fix it.
High Humidity or Moisture
If you notice high humidity or moisture in your basement,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t delay. Water can seep into your home through cracks and crevices, causing high humidity and moisture. We’ll fix it.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Middle River, MD
The cost of Basement Water Damage Restoration in Middle River, MD can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Prices can vary.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the mold growth and the size of the affected area. |
| Dehumidification and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of humidity. |
| Equipment Rental and Labor | $1,000 – $3,000 | The type and duration of equipment rental and labor required. |
|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the damage and the type of testing required. |
